Can someone explain to me how the 10 IP limitation is calculated for home users?  I have received several e-mail notifications that I am close or over my 10 users, and I suspect it is because I have changed several IPs from DHCP to static.  I suspect that when I change the IP of a component in a given day, Astaro will flag it as two IPs used during that day.  Does a daily overage in one day add on to the next?  Is there a way to refresh the list?

  • No daily averaging... the IPs "live" in the licensing DB for 7 days ... so if an IP has not been used for at least 7 days, that licensed IP is released.
